Hyrum Pereira did not stumble into restoration work. He has been in the industry since 2004. He moved specifically to Las Vegas in 2010, spent years learning this market from the inside, and eventually co-founded a franchise location with Hector Manrique at 2777 North Lamb Boulevard. That is a different entry point than a franchise sale to an investor looking for a business to own. It is the story of someone who built expertise in restoration, chose Las Vegas deliberately, and then built something here. Context like that matters when you are deciding who to hand your flooded home to.
PuroClean of East Las Vegas is a franchise of PuroSystems LLC, which has operated since 2001 and now runs over four hundred and seventy-five locations nationally. The franchise model provides Hyrum and Hector with standardized IICRC-certified training and operational infrastructure that an independent operator would have to build from scratch. The east Las Vegas location covers Henderson, Paradise, Whitney, and the downtown corridor. They carry biohazard remediation capability, which is not a standard offering in the residential restoration market.
The Yelp data for this location is genuinely impressive: four point four out of five across six hundred and eight reviews. That volume is hard to manufacture and the patterns that emerge from it tend to be reliable signals. Reviewers consistently mention responsiveness and crew professionalism. The east valley geographic coverage, combined with Hyrum Pereira's local market experience, is reflected in that review history.
Where I paused was a platform called PissedConsumer, which aggregates negative customer experiences for the PuroClean brand overall. The brand-wide rating there is one point six out of five across fifty-three reviews. The complaints include allegations of theft and damage to personal property during jobs, billing disputes for work that customers say was not authorized upfront, and cases of companies holding personal property hostage during fee disputes. I have to be clear about what that means: these are brand-wide complaints for the PuroClean franchise system, not complaints I can specifically attribute to the East Las Vegas location operated by Hyrum Pereira and Hector Manrique. The brand-wide pattern is worth knowing about. Whether it reflects the practices of this specific franchise is a different question. The contrast between six hundred and eight positive Yelp reviews at the local level and the brand-wide complaint patterns suggests the East Las Vegas location may be operating differently than some of the complainants' franchises.
BBB status: not accredited, and no BBB rating is available for this specific location. That is a neutral data point, not a red flag on its own, but it does limit one avenue of independent verification.
On insurance, PuroClean East works with insurance companies. They do not have an in-house public adjuster. For a standard water damage claim that is accepted and processed normally, that is usually sufficient. For a claim that is disputed, underpaid, or involves a complex scope question, you are handling the insurance negotiation yourself. That gap matters more the larger and more complicated your claim is.
The biohazard capability deserves a mention because it is genuinely uncommon in the residential restoration market. Most contractors you would call for water damage do not hold the certifications or carry the equipment for biohazard remediation. For a standard flooded bathroom or monsoon intrusion, it is excess capability. But if you are ever in a situation that crosses into biohazard territory, having a contractor already familiar with your property and capable of handling that work without subcontracting is a real convenience.
The bottom line is that PuroClean East Las Vegas has earned its local reputation. Six hundred and eight Yelp reviews at four point four stars is not a fluke. Hyrum Pereira's specific market knowledge, built over years working in Las Vegas restoration before founding this location, is a meaningful differentiator from a franchise dropped into a zip code by a remote owner. For a homeowner in the east valley dealing with water damage or a mold issue, this is a legitimate choice.
The honest comparison to M&M Restoration comes down to the insurance advocacy question. M&M integrated public adjuster is a structural advantage when a claim gets complicated. PuroClean East does not have that function. For a straightforward, accepted insurance claim in the east valley, the geographic convenience and local track record of PuroClean East make it a credible option. For a dispute, a large loss, or a complex multi-hazard job, M&M integrated model provides a layer of protection that PuroClean cannot match.
